Municipal market commentary (2024)

Key takeaways

  • The power of higher income generation helped muni bonds absorb an increase in long-term Treasury yields.
  • Investors are recognizing that lengthening duration may benefit portfolios in the short-term should yields move lower.
  • The muni bond market is starting the second quarter with relative strength, supported by above-average yields and positive technical and fundamental factors.

In the first quarter, the municipal bond market displayed relative strength in the face of rising Treasury yields. The U.S. economy remains strong, and municipal credit fundamentals are benefiting from a resilient consumer and strong labor market. Demand for tax-exempt income has led to relative outperformance for municipal bonds. We believe demand could strengthen as investors consider shifting to longer duration municipals ahead of U.S. Federal Reserve rate cuts.

Investors may enjoy attractive total returns from income alone.

Investing in municipal bonds involves risks such as interest rate risk, credit risk and market risk. The value of the portfolio will fluctuate based on the value of the underlying securities. There are special risks associated with investments in high yield bonds, hedging activities and the potential use of leverage. Portfolios that include lower rated municipal bonds, commonly referred to as “high yield” or “junk” bonds, which are considered to be speculative, the credit and investment risk is heightened for the portfolio. Bond insurance guarantees only the payment of principal and interest on the bond when due, and not the value of the bonds themselves, which will fluctuate with the bond market and the financial success of the issuer and the insurer. No representation is made as to an insurer’s ability to meet their commitments. This information should not replace an investor’s consultation with a financial professional regarding their tax situation. Nuveen is not a tax advisor. Investors should contact a tax professional regarding the appropriateness of tax-exempt investments in their portfolio. If sold prior to maturity, municipal securities are subject to gain/losses based on the level of interest rates, market conditions and the credit quality of the issuer. Income may be subject to the alternative minimum tax (AMT) and/or state and local taxes, based on the state of residence. Income from municipal bonds held by a portfolio could be declared taxable because of unfavorable changes in tax laws, adverse interpretations by the Internal Revenue Service or state tax authorities, or noncompliant conduct of a bond issuer.
